Abstract

The present disclosure provides a system architecture for designing and monitoring privacy-aware services and improving privacy regulation compliance. A privacy-preserving knowledge graph (PPKG) system provides functionality for modelling and analyzing processes that use, share, or request sensitive data from users and the outcomes of such functionality may be utilized to modify the design of the processes (e.g., to improve security of the process, regulatory compliance of the process, and the like). The PPKG system may also be used to modify the process, such as to write code that may be compiled into executable form and deployed to a run-time environment. A privacy-preserving posture (PPP) system monitors the run-time environment and analyzes where processes obtain, store, and share sensitive data. The PPP system may identify run-time vulnerabilities that may pose risks with respect to the sensitive data, as well as areas where modifications could be made to improve regulatory compliance.
